Weymouth-based Advanced Green Insulation has made a gift of over $32,000 to South Shore Health’s Breast Care Center, a licensed clinic within the Dana-Farber/Brigham and Women’s Cancer Center in clinical affiliation with South Shore Hospital.

Advanced Green Insulation performs services for new and existing homes and businesses throughout Massachusetts. The owners of Advanced Green Insulation, Israel Jesus Barroso and Kathy DoAmaral started their company in 2012 and have been located in Weymouth for six years.

In honor of Breast Cancer Awareness Month, Barroso and Doamaral decided to donate a portion of the company’s October profits to the Breast Care Center.

“This is a very important cause,” DoAmaral explained. “We wanted to give back to our community and on behalf of the breast cancer survivors on our staff.”

On Saturday, October 31, Barroso and DoAmaral brought together employees, dressed in pink shirts, masks and gloves, and members of the South Shore Health Foundation for a check presentation and celebratory breakfast in the company’s warehouse, which was decorated with pink insulation.

“We are so very grateful and humbled by the generous donation made by Mr. Barosso, Ms. DoAmaral and their staff," said Jennifer Croes, Executive Director of the Cancer Center.

“The funds donated by Advanced Green Insulation will be used to support patient care services, operational expenses and the expansion of technological capabilities in imaging and diagnostic pathology,” Croes said.

A portion of the funding will also support the Compassionate Cancer Needs Fund to help cancer patients and their families in financial need.

The Breast Care Center sees upwards of approximately 2,000 new patients each year. The clinic, which serves Southeastern Massachusetts and other locations, specializes in cancerous and non-cancerous diseases of the breast.

Additionally, patients who are at an increased risk for breast cancer are cared for, evaluated and followed by providers. Mammography and diagnostic imaging services are available on site.
